MP Hasnain Masoodi takes stock of COVID-19 facilities at SDH Pampore

PAMPORE: Member of Parliament in Lok Sabha for Anantnag Parliamentary constituency, Justice (Retd), Hasnain Masoodi on Tuesday visited Sub District Hospital Pampore, PHC Awantipora, Sub District Hospital Tral, PHC Khrew and PHC Wuyan and took stock of the quality health services and medical facilities being provided to the patients.
In sub district hospital Pampore Hasnain Masoodi held a meeting with Registered medical officer Dr Mohammad Ashraf regarding COVID-19.
He said that he would try to knock the doors of every official so that Sub District Hospital Pampore has availability of all facilities so that the patients do not suffer.
While praising the efforts of health officials he said that they were battling the pandemic without caring for their lives as they are the front line workers.
He said that he wanted to check the facilities on spot and discuss the challenges that the whole world is facing with the doctors , adding that what was in line of action as Pampore SDH is the busiest hospital in the Pulwama district.
He also told Kashmir Reader that the testing capacity in the hospital was adequate and they are working with full capacity.
“There would hardly be supplies for today and tomorrow,” he said, adding that they are busy in battling against the pandemic and we must facilitate them. He further said that he had provided 35 lakh rupees to Pulwama district for two ventilators.
He told Kashmir Reader that there were oxygen supplies but that would take time and he was not sure whether the oxygen plant would be ready within 40 days which the administration has promised.

As per the information he received from health officials the vaccination has ended today.
He said that he would contact Director Health services Kashmir and meet deputy Commissioner Pulwama regarding the matter.
He told Kashmir Reader that he would try to provide the necessary medicine at the earliest as the hospital has a pivotal place in the district so that nobody would be annoyed.
He appealed to the public not to remain ignorant as she had found that out of every 40 tests 2 people turn to be positive. He also appealed to the government that Vaccines must be available as it is the biggest defence against the covid 19.
